Standing Figure with Arms Upward is an original artwork attributed to Paul Grain and realized in the first years of … Read more Standing Figure with Arms Upward is an original artwork attributed to Paul Grain and realized in the first years of the 20th Century. Cardboard passepartout included (cm 49 x 34). Very good conditions. The artwork represents a standing nude female figure with the arms upward. In the right hand, she has a pointed object. The contours of the figure are defined with soft pencil strokes. The silhouette of the female is very elegant and thin and their proportions are perfect and simple. See less
